Product Description:

The F8.F5.S1E-33E2 is produced by KEB and belongs to the F5 Combivert Axis Drives series. This drive module serves as the power interface for a single automation axis, altering motor voltage and frequency so that speed and torque follow the machine controller’s commands. It supports regenerative braking, advanced current control, and integration with servo feedback loops, making it suitable for packaging lines, robotic cells, and other dynamic applications. That combination supports rapid speed changes, repeatable positioning, and stable motion during demanding cyclic operation.

The control philosophy is servo, which means the inverter modulates current from real-time position or velocity feedback rather than from open-loop scalar methods. Thermal management relies on water cooling, so a closed coolant circuit removes heat from the power stage and allows installation in sealed cabinets without heavy internal airflow. The power section accepts three-phase 400 VAC/DC mains or rectified bus connections, which matches its 400 V voltage class and maintains appropriate insulation spacing throughout the unit. A carrier switching rate of 16 kHz reduces audible motor noise and provides finer current resolution at low speeds. Liquid cooling also helps limit heat buildup around nearby cabinet components when the drive operates under sustained load.

The integrated braking transistor routes regenerated energy to an external resistor, so no separate chopper module is required. During fault conditions, the drive can withstand 150% of rated current, while short acceleration periods are supported by a 125% current capability. As a frequency inverter, the unit synthesizes a variable output waveform from the incoming DC link, and it can also operate from a direct DC supply in common-bus layouts. This makes it suitable for systems that share bus power across multiple coordinated axes. The housing uses form factor code E, which sets the frame dimensions and mounting hole pattern for cabinet installation.
